Background

The basic volume analysis is that buyers are in control when the price is increased. The purchase volume takes place at the offer price and represents the lowest advertised price at which sellers sell their shares. When someone buys shares at the current asking price, it shows that someone wants the shares and is included in the purchase volume metric.

Function

[blackcat] L1 Stock Volume Analyzer plot colorful volume candles with different meanings: red for red price bars, green for green price bars, yellow for active buying volume, fuchsia for active selling volume, navy for high active buying volume turn over rate, and white for high active selling volume turn over rate.

Pros and Cons

Pros:

1. extract volume detailed information to judge price trend together
2. price convergence and divergence help to identify long and short entry points

Cons:

1. price convergence and divergence visually works well only for <= 8H time frame
2. this indicator only works for stock trading pairs


Remarks

In order to put price and volume in a unified scale, this indicator is scaled. This scaling is not suitable for all markets. At present, it has only been optimized in the stock exchange market.

OVERVIEW The [blackcat] L1 Stock Volume Analyzer is a TradingView script designed to provide comprehensive analysis of stock volumes through various indicators like active buying/selling volume, bull/bear price levels, and turnover rates. It also includes visualizations such as candlestick plots and fills to represent different market conditions and potential trading signals.
FEATURES

Active Buying/Selling Calculation: Determines the strength of buying and selling pressure based on the relationship between prices and trading volume.
Bull/Bear Price Levels: Calculates upper and lower thresholds for bullish and bearish trends using Exponential Moving Averages (EMA).
Turnover Rate: Measures the liquidity of trades relative to the overall trading volume.
Candlestick Plots: Visualizes regular and adjusted volume data along with active buying/selling and turnover rates.
Price Trend Analysis: Uses EMAs to detect and visualize price trends alongside volume data.
Trading Signals: Identifies crossover points to generate buy and sell signals.
Alerts: Sets up alert conditions for both buy and sell signals.
HOW TO USE

Add the Script: Copy the script code into the Pine Script editor in TradingView and save it as an indicator.
Configure Settings: Adjust the Volume Scaler input parameter to scale the bull/bear price levels according to your preference.
Interpret Data: Analyze the plotted candles and fills to gauge current market sentiment and identify potential entry/exit points.
Set Alerts: Enable alert notifications for the generated buy or sell signals by setting up alerts in TradingView's settings.
LIMITATIONS

The accuracy of the active buying/selling calculation may vary depending on the specific security being analyzed.
The script assumes certain market conditions; results may differ in volatile markets.
Alert effectiveness can be influenced by the frequency and timing of signal generation.
